Health & Social Care
An Applied Course - worth 2 GCSEs.
This double award prepares pupils who may wish to have a career in the health and social care industry, or in early years setting (e.g. a nursery).
The course covers 4 compulsory units:
- Health, social care and early years provision (coursework).
- Promoting health and well being (coursework).
- Understanding personal development and relationships (external examination).
- Safeguarding and protecting individuals (external examination).
How will the work be assessed?
- Controlled assessment will account for 60% of the final award and external examinations account for 40% of the final award.
- Two units will be assessed through controlled assessment, each worth 30% of the overall award.
- Two units will be assessed by external examination, each worth 20% of the final award.
Are there different levels of entry?
There is one tier of entry offering the full range of grades A*-G.
Reminder.
It is essential that candidates who opt for this course organise at least one week of their Year 10 work experience in an appropriate health, social care or early years setting.
